Output 3fcf60fe516ef38e7cdc9e9f886b1e1dbee8ef3ef1a35087f0e4e7aaa507bbe9:13

value
6679339
script pubkey
OP_0 OP_PUSHBYTES_32 d813f9ce45ec3a102c9bb1cdc6ea07884f99309946aa4431583edadac0ccda9d
address
bc1qmqflnnj9asapqtymk8xud6s83p8ejvyeg64ygv2c8mdd4sxvm2wsp2gswv
transaction
3fcf60fe516ef38e7cdc9e9f886b1e1dbee8ef3ef1a35087f0e4e7aaa507bbe9